    Who is Dr. Faber, Neurologist in Saint Louis, MO?

    Dr. Cheryl Faber, MD is a Neurologist, who primarily practices in Saint Louis, MO with 2 additional practice locations. She is board certified. Dr. Faber graduated from University of Wales in Great Britain and completed her residency at University Ks Med Center. Dr. Faber is fluent in English and Chinese,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Faber’s practice accepts Medicare, Aetna, Cigna,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     Is this Dr. Cheryl Faber aff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Faber is affiliated with Missouri Baptist Medical Center which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
